Strategic Alliance Announced
February 2010
Hurricane, UT
We are pleased to
announce the strategic alliance that
has recently been formed between DATS
Trucking and Best Overnite Express.
On March 1, 2010, Best and DATS will
move forward together as two separate
and entirely independent entities
working towards the common goals of:
- providing the
best service in the market
- having the most
efficient operations
- employing the
most skilled and talented
transportation industry experts
- making our
companies profitable in the
immediate future as well as for the
long term
There has been no
merger or acquisition, but rather a
joint effort to partner our
strengths, consolidate operations in
the market, to be more efficient and
to focus in the service areas each
knows best. Our strategic alliance
will focus on consolidating efforts
specifically in the states of CA and
NV. Best Overnite will manage all
operations in CA, while DATS will do
the same in our core states.
By pooling our efforts and expertise,
Best Overnite and DATS will be poised
for tremendous growth and limitless
success in the LTL markets we service
for many years to come.

Change
in Operations for New Mexico
November 2009
Hurricane, UT
Dear
Valued Customers,
During these tough economic times, it
is good to recognize our humble
beginnings and what has made us "Your
Quality Service Carrier”. It is also
good to recognize our strengths in
this very competitive market. We
appreciate your business and your
trust in us.
As we review our history of declining
tonnage and revenues in our New
Mexico market, a decision has been
made to cease operations in the state
of New Mexico. Long mileage and low
volumes combined with minimal results
and weak demand from our customers
has led us to this decision. Our plan
is to close our service centers in
New Mexico within the next 2 weeks.
Here
is the planned schedule for this
change in operations:
11/20–Farmington terminal closure
11/25–Last day of pickups destined to
New Mexico
12/01–Las Cruces
terminal closure
12/02–Albuquerque terminal closure
Going forward, this change will allow
us to concentrate on our core service
areas and continue to provide Quality
Service in those lanes.

New
North Salt Lake Office Opened
October 13, 2008
Hurricane, UT

After
several months of extensive
renovation our newest facility is now
open for business. The new facility
is located on 20 acres in North Salt
Lake, Utah. Some highlights of this
location include a 77 door dock,
5,400 sq. ft. of office space and a
full-service, 6,000 sq. ft. shop
complete with a full length lube pit
. The large size of this new facility
allowed us to combine both our
dedicated retail distribution
services and our LTL freight
operations in the same building.
Thank you to our loyal customers,
employees, vendors and contractors
that made this new facility possible.

DATS Participates in UDOT's "Drive Truck Smart" Campaign
April 25, 2007
West Jordan, UT
Click this photo for additional photos of this event.

The Utah Department of Transportation (UDOT) Motor Carrier Services
Division continued its educational campaign today encouraging teen beginning drivers to “Drive
Truck Smart” with a hands-on demonstration at Copper Hills High School in West Jordan, UT. DATS is participating in this
campaign by applying vinyl wraps to several trailers and providing equipment and employees to staff events around the state. At
this event, drivers’ education students were able to sit inside the cab of a semi truck surrounded by cars they couldn’t see for
the “blind spots.” Demonstrations were also held related to stopping distances. This gave them an up-close look at how
commercial motor vehicles behave differently than passenger vehicles. “As part of our Commercial Vehicle
Safety Plan we saw the need to help educate young drivers on ways to drive safely and courteously around commercial motor
vehicles,” said Rick Clasby, Motor Carrier Services division director.
“We have received an incredible amount of support from the trucking industry as well, receiving national recognition from the
American Trucking Association and other states that want to utilize our educational materials,” said Rick Clasby, Motor Carrier
Services division director for UDOT. “Our goal is to reduce the number of deaths resulting from crashes with commercial trucks
by 41 percent across the nation by 2008”.
